What Exactly is a Wheelchair Accessible Vehicle (WAV)?
A Wheelchair Accessible Vehicle (WAV) represents a specialized mobility solution designed for total freedom. These are standard cars or vans that have undergone professional, expert conversion to safely and comfortably accommodate a wheelchair user, whether they are traveling as a passenger or taking the wheel.
The key to a WAV lies in its bespoke modifications, such as specialized ramps, mechanical lifts, and re-engineered interiors that streamline the entire process of entering, securing, and exiting the vehicle. WAVs are fundamentally about independence, and they come in numerous shapes and sizes to suit every individual’s precise requirements.

Your Guide to WAV Ramps
Understanding the specific type of access system available is key to making the right choice, particularly when considering ramps. The choice between a manual, powered, or assisted system depends entirely on the user’s mobility and the caregiver’s strength.
Manual Ramps
Commonly found in smaller or mid-sized WAVs, manual ramps are the most straightforward access method.
- Operation: They are lightweight and often incorporate a spring-assist feature, allowing for easy folding and unfolding by hand.
- Benefits: Highly cost-effective and low maintenance. Some designs can be folded completely flat when the wheelchair user is not present, improving rear visibility.
Powered Ramps and Winches
For users who require less physical effort during entry, or for heavier power wheelchairs, powered assistance is ideal.
- Powered Ramps: These ramps are deployed and retracted automatically via a button or remote control, providing exceptional convenience. They can be integrated with a powered tailgate for fully automated rear access.
- Powered Winches: A valuable addition to any ramp, a winch gently and smoothly pulls the wheelchair up the incline, significantly reducing the strain and effort required from caregivers.
WAV Lifts and Platforms
When the vehicle floor is higher, or for larger, heavier powerchairs, a mechanical lift is often the most stable and controlled solution.
Chairlifts
These mechanical devices are designed to smoothly raise or lower the wheelchair and occupant, providing a stable platform for transfer.
- Usage: Lifts are beneficial for heavier powerchairs or scooters and are typically installed inside larger vehicles (like converted vans) at the rear or side door.

Underfloor Wheelchair Lifts
For maximum cabin flexibility and a clean interior aesthetic, underfloor lifts are innovative and discreet.
- Concealment: These lifts are stored entirely out of sight beneath the vehicle chassis when not in use.
- Deployment: They typically deploy from a side door, creating a flat platform that raises the wheelchair directly to the vehicle floor height.
- Advantage: This ensures the maximum number of standard seats can be retained, preserving the vehicle’s original interior look and passenger capacity.
